Quick answer

Johnson City has 11 go-to e-bike routes covering about 45 miles, and most riders start with the Tweetsie Trail.

11Mapped routes
~45 miCombined distance
+2420 ftTotal climbing
8/11Shared-use paths
Tennessee trail baseline

Tennessee Public Chapter 651 updates when local governments and state agencies may regulate or prohibit Class 1, Class 2, and Class 3 e-bike use on certain paths ...
